How to perform operation on flask-admin database columns to store results in other column of same table - flask-sqlalchemy

I am building flask admin app where I need to store total of couple of integer columns into third column of same table.
from flask_sqlalchemy import SQLAlchemy
from flask_admin.contrib.sqla import ModelView
from flask import Flask
import os
from flask_admin import Admin
application = Flask(__name__)
project_dir = os.path.dirname(os.path.abspath(__file__))
database_file = "sqlite:///{}".format(os.path.join(project_dir,"testing.db"))
application = Flask(__name__)
application.config["SQLALCHEMY_DATABASE_URI"] = database_file
application.config['SQLALCHEMY_TRACK_MODIFICATIONS'] = False
application.secret_key = "ssshhhh"
db = SQLAlchemy(application)
admin = Admin(application,name="FLASK")
class Test(db.Model):
id = db.Column("ID",db.Integer,primary_key=True)
first_no = db.Column("First_no",db.Integer)
second_no = db.Column("Second_no",db.Integer)
total = db.Column("Total",db.Integer)
class TestView(ModelView):
page_size = 20
edit_modal = True
if __name__ == '__main__':
db.create_all()
admin.add_view(TestView(Test, db.session))
application.run(debug=True)
Above example let me store values in all three fields manually which is not expected.
Expected result that I am looking for get total of couple of integers and stores in database as well.

Two options you can use:
Use the onupdate parameter of Column to set the value of total on update, for example:
total = db.Column("Total", db.Integer, onupdate=first_no + second_no)
Use a hybrid_property to calculated the total without storing the value:
class Test(db.Model):
...
#hybrid_property
def total(self):
return self.first_no + self.second_no

How to add username and name columns to pandas dataframe with search_all_tweets lookup in python

I am trying to collect tweets from 2022 using Twitter API. I can record the tweet_fields for the tweets, but I can't figure out how to add columns for the username and name (the user_fields) for each tweet.
I'm running the following code:
import requests
import os
import json
import tweepy
import pandas as pd
from datetime import timedelta
import datetime
bearer_token = "my_bearer_token_here"
keyword = "#WomeninSTEM"
start_time = "2022-01-01T12:01:00Z"
end_time = "2023-01-01T12:01:00Z"
client = tweepy.Client(bearer_token=bearer_token)
responses = client.search_all_tweets(query = "#WomeninSTEM", max_results= 500, start_time=start_time, end_time = end_time,
user_fields = ["username", "name"],
tweet_fields =["in_reply_to_user_id", "author_id", "lang",
"public_metrics", "created_at", "conversation_id"])
**##I can't get the username or name columns to work here.**
column = []
for i in range(len(responses.data)) :
row = []
Username = responses.data[i]["username"]
row.append(Username)
name = responses.data[i]["name"]
row.append(name)
text = responses.data[i].text
row.append(text)
favoriteCount = responses.data[i].public_metrics["like_count"]
row.append(favoriteCount)
retweet_count = responses.data[i].public_metrics["retweet_count"]
row.append(retweet_count)
reply_count = responses.data[i].public_metrics["reply_count"]
row.append(reply_count)
quote_count = responses.data[i].public_metrics["quote_count"]
row.append(quote_count)
created = responses.data[i].created_at
row.append(created)
ReplyTo = responses.data[i].text.split(" ")[0]
row.append(ReplyTo)
ReplyToUID = responses.data[i].in_reply_to_user_id
row.append(ReplyToUID)
ConversationID = responses.data[i]["conversation_id"]
row.append(ConversationID)
column.append(row)
data = pd.DataFrame(column)
Whenever I try and include username and name, I get this error:KeyError Traceback (most recent call last)
Assuming you're querying at https://api.twitter.com/2/tweets/[...], the response does not have a 'username' or a 'name' parameter, that's why you're getting a KeyError when trying to access them.
It does have an 'author_id' parameter, which you can use to perform an additional query at https://api.twitter.com/2/users/:id and retrieve 'username' and 'name'.

Select a random row with MySQL:
SELECT column FROM table
ORDER BY RAND()
LIMIT 5
Select a random row with IBM DB2
SELECT column, RAND() as IDX
FROM table
ORDER BY IDX FETCH FIRST 1 ROWS ONLY
Select a random row with Microsoft SQL Server:
SELECT TOP 5 column FROM table
ORDER BY NEWID()
Select a random record with Oracle:
SELECT column FROM
( SELECT column FROM table
ORDER BY dbms_random.value )
WHERE rownum = 5
Select a random row with PostgreSQL:
SELECT column FROM table
ORDER BY RANDOM()
LIMIT 5
Select a random row with SQLite:
SELECT column FROM table
ORDER BY
RANDOM() LIMIT 5;
